#fdbc44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fdbc44 is composed of 99.2% red, 73.7%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.7%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 38.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 62.9%. #fdbc44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#fb7900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#fdbc44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fdbc44 has RGB values of R:253, G:188,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.73,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16628804.

Shades and Tints of #fdbc44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070500 is the darkest color, while #fffb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dbc44
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a29b is the less saturated color, while #fdbc44 is the most saturated one.
